Discussion:
Retirar vários caracteres especiais
(too old to reply)
Marcela
2005-11-21 15:58:04 UTC
Permalink
Como faço para vários caracteres especiais em SQL?
Como: 120/254-524.2563-44
Para ficar: 120254524256344

Obrigada desde já
Marcelo Colla
2005-11-21 16:08:04 UTC
Permalink
Marcela, tem que usar um replace mesmo, vc. pode executar junto os varias
vezes em um update exemplo

declare @string varchar(1000)
set @String = '120/254-524.2563-44'

Select replace(replace(replace(@string,'/',''),'-',''),'.','') -- de uma
vez so

Select @String = replace(@string,'/','')
Select @String = replace(@string,'-','')
Select @String = replace(@string,'.','')

Select @String -- varias vezes em update

Abs.
Post by Marcela
Como faço para vários caracteres especiais em SQL?
Como: 120/254-524.2563-44
Para ficar: 120254524256344
Obrigada desde já
Loading...